Admission

There is an exam namely Combined Entrance Exam. It is conducted by Assam Science and Technology University. It is a university based in Guwahati, Assam. It is run by the state government of Assam. Every year the exam is being conducted by the same university to get into various state government engineering colleges of Assam. I have given the foresaid exam and got selected in it.

Placement Experience:

From 5th sem students are allowed to participate in oncampus summar internship and from. 7th semester starting they are allowed for 6 month internship and Full time roles . There is a Training and placement Cell in our college there are some heads of this cell they are senior professors and it have final year students in senior coordinator position and 3 rd year study as probationary. Students bring the companies which fulfills the criteria of TNP cell and each company have their own eligibility criteria and selection procedure. Mostly companies allows 6 cgpa without any active backlog students . But some high paying companies requires 7 or more cgpa . In 3rd year Cisco , microsoft, public sapiens, Tech Mahindra, Accenture ,Oracle and many more companies visited in our campus and hired good amounts of students for summer internship and mostly offers full time role as ppo to students. In 4th year a lots of company like Novartis, amazon, flipkart,aditya birla, Cisco , Deloitte, oracle,ukg, Motorola, siemens , IBM and many more startups visited college and hired .Some paid 15+ CTC and some 6 to 10 CTC . Almost 40% of students are placed till December this year from each branch . Placement Experience:

From 6th semester students are offered various internship opportunities and placements opportunities start afterhand from the onset of 8th semester. Last year in 2024, the placement record stood at the highest pachage offered 52.89LPA and an average of 13.54LPA. More than 200 companies visited and more than 600 offers were made.
